Key Features to Look For
When shopping for a spider repellent, look for these important features. These details tell you how well the product will work for your needs.
- Repellent Type: Do you want a spray, a plug-in device, or a natural barrier? Sprays offer quick action. Devices work over time without constant spraying.
- Coverage Area: Check the label to see how large an area the product protects. A small spray bottle might only cover one doorway. A larger device could protect an entire room.
- Active Ingredients (If Applicable): Natural repellents often use essential oils like peppermint or cedar. Chemical repellents use stronger ingredients. Know what you are comfortable using around kids and pets.
- Longevity: How long does the protection last? Some sprays need reapplication every few weeks. Devices might last several months.

Natural vs. Chemical
Many modern repellents focus on natural ingredients because they are safer for families and pets. Peppermint oil is a popular choice. Spiders strongly dislike the strong smell. Cedarwood is another common, natural deterrent.
Chemical options often use synthetic pesticides. These kill or repel spiders aggressively. If you choose a chemical product, always read the safety warnings carefully. Never spray these near food preparation areas.

10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Spider Repellents
Q: Do all spider repellents actually work?
A: Most reputable repellents work by masking scents or using strong odors spiders hate. However, effectiveness depends on the spider species and how consistently you apply the product.
Q: Are essential oils safe for my dog or cat?
A: Some essential oils, like tea tree oil, can be toxic to pets if ingested. Peppermint is generally safer when used as a diluted spray barrier, but always check the label or ask your vet if you have concerns.
Q: How often should I reapply a peppermint spray?
A: Typically, you should reapply outdoor sprays every two to four weeks, or after heavy rain. Indoor sprays might last longer, perhaps a month.
Q: Can I use these products to kill spiders instead of just repelling them?
A: Most repellents aim to keep spiders away without killing them. If you want to kill spiders instantly, you need a dedicated insecticide spray, not just a repellent.
Q: Will a plug-in device work in a very large room?
A: Plug-in devices usually have limited range, often protecting a single average-sized room. Large, open-plan areas might need two devices for full coverage.
Q: What is the main difference between a chemical and a natural repellent?
A: Chemical repellents use synthetic poisons to deter spiders. Natural repellents rely on strong plant scents, like herbs, that spiders find unpleasant.
Q: Do I need to clean the area before using a repellent?
A: Yes, cleaning helps quality. Wiping down dusty areas or removing existing cobwebs improves the product’s ability to stick and last longer.
Q: How long before I see results after using a repellent?
A: You might notice fewer spiders within 24 to 48 hours. Strong odors deter them immediately, but it takes time for all existing spiders to move out of the treated zone.
Q: Are ultrasonic devices effective against all types of spiders?
A: Some experts suggest that ultrasonic devices work best on common house spiders. Very large or established populations might require scent-based or contact treatments.
Q: Where is the best place to spray around my house to stop spiders?
A: Focus on entry points. Spray around window frames, door thresholds, cracks in the foundation, and any utility pipes entering the house.
